Navigating Career Transitions with Smart Financial Planning
Planning a career transition? It's an exciting time filled with opportunity, but it also requires careful thought. Your financial health is crucial during this period, so implementing a smart financial plan can minimize stress and provide a smoother journey. First, assess your current economic situation. Figure out your income, expenses, and savings. This gives a clear view of where you stand financially. Next, estimate your revenue during the transition stage. Will there be any disparities?
Develop a budget that incorporates your new financial situation. Identify areas where you can reduce expenses and focus on essential spending. Consider establishing an emergency fund to provide a safety net in case of unforeseen costs. Finally, research different financial instruments that can assist you during the transition.

Secure Your Future: Essential Insurance Coverage for Professionals
Professionals construct their careers with dedication. Yet, unforeseen situations can impact even the most strategically designed futures. To reduce these risks and safeguard your economic well-being, it's crucial to have the right insurance protection.
A comprehensive portfolio of professional insurance can deliver much-needed assurance of mind. Consider these core types:
* **Liability Insurance:** Safeguards you from financial consequences arising from suits related to your professional activities.
* **Disability Insurance:** Covers a portion of your income if you become unable from working due to illness or injury.
* **Professional Liability Insurance:** Directly targets allegations related to your professional skills.
